Mrs. Pongracz received her Bachelor of Science Degree in Secondary Education from Kutztown University with a double major of social studies and Spanish. She later received her Master of Education Degree from Kutztown University and a certificate as a reading specialist. She has taught computer classes and was an adjunct faculty member for Lehigh Carbon Community College for whom she taught GED classes. During her time working at Xerox and Autodesk, she gained experience in event planning while supporting sales staffs of up to 135 people.

In 1996, Mrs. Pongracz founded a support group in the Lehigh Valley for people with Spasmodic Dysphonia (SD), a neurological voice disorder. Under her leadership, the group has promoted awareness by sending literature to 800 local physicians, placing articles about SD in several local newspapers, speaking on a local radio talk show and presenting to Kutztown University’s speech pathology students. The group has also done several fundraisers, including a benefit concert to raise money for research on SD. Mrs. Pongracz served as the Regional Coordinator of the Mid-Atlantic States for the National Spasmodic Dysphonia Association for two years and continues to lead the local support group today.
